The classic hotel fold

This is the most common and easiest way to fold towels. Simply lay the towel flat, fold it in thirds lengthwise, and then fold it in half twice.

The classic hotel fold is not only easy to do, but it also saves space and creates a neat, uniform look in your linen closet.

The spa roll

If you want to create a spa-like atmosphere in your bathroom, consider the spa roll. It’s an easy and stylish way to store your towels.

To do this, lay the towel out flat, fold it in half lengthwise twice, and then roll it up from one end to the other. The result is a compact, easy-to-grab roll that’s perfect for placing on a shelf or in a basket.

The decorative swan

For those who want to add a touch of elegance to their bathroom, the decorative swan is the way to go. It may seem complicated at first, but with a little practice, you can create a beautiful towel display.

Simply fold the towel in half diagonally, roll the ends towards the middle, then fold it in half so the rolls are on the outside. Bend the towel in half to form the swan’s neck and head, and there you have it – a beautiful swan!

The hanging towel

This method is perfect for hand towels or towels you want to hang on a rack. Start by folding your towel in half lengthwise, then fold it in half again.

Take the folded edge and fold it down about a third of the way. Flip the towel over, and you have a hanging towel that will stay put and look neat on your rack.

The fan fold

The fan fold is a fun and decorative way to display your towels. Start by folding your towel in half, then accordion fold it starting from one end.

Once you are done, fold it in half with the folds on the outside. This creates a fan shape that is perfect for displaying on your guest bed or bathroom countertop.
